Audi intends to discontinue all combustion engines in its new cars, and will only launch EVs starting in 2026. The spy photos from northern Europe show that the 2024 Audi S4 will receive an ICE final, complete with quad tips, to match the performance cars. Although it appears to have the final headlights and body, those taillights are only a preliminary setup.

2024 Audi S4 Avant Changes
The prototype does not have a diesel engine, as the European S4 and larger S6 use a TDI powertrain. You can choose between a sedan or wagon body style with the 3.0-liter V6 Diesel. It also comes with some horrendous fake exhaust tips. Audi also sells vehicles in the United States and other countries with a gasoline V6 engine.
Since the diesel-powered S4 already features a mild hybrid system, logic suggests that its replacement will include some form of electrification. We hope it doesn’t reduce to a four-cylinder engine, as was the case with the Mercedes-AMG C43. There were rumors that Audi would downsize the next-gen Audi A4 to the MQB platform with a transversely mounted engine in order to save $1 billion. But this won’t happen.
Exterior
The exterior styling is evolutionary with new flush door handles, but expect a revolution inside. Previous spy shots of A4 Avants have shown a completely revamped dashboard. Unfortunately, those who prefer cleanly integrated screens will be disappointed to learn that the next-generation model will include a pair of displays on the dashboard.
Strangely, the A4/S4 prototypes were only seen testing in the more practical wagon version. Audi has not yet spoken out about the sedan being dropped, but we should keep in mind that the next Volkswagen Passat will only be available as an estate model. Sedans are no longer in fashion, but we still find it hard to believe that there will be an A4 Sedan. It makes sense, however, since the Ingolstadt-based company also offers the A5 Sportback.
The wraps will be removed later in the year. Logic tells us that Audi will first unveil the regular A4. The RS4 and S4 will arrive in 2024. The latter will be powered by a plug-in hybrid engine. Officially, the RS models with four-cylinder engines are no longer available. The super wagon will still be powered by a V6.

Safety and Driver-Assistance Features
While the sports sedan comes with several standard driver-assist features, other options like adaptive cruise control or lane-keeping assistance are available only on the Prestige model.
